A cookie is a small piece of data from a website which asks permission to be placed on your hard drive. Once you agree to the placement of the cookie on your hard drive, it starts collecting data used to analyze traffic or keeps track of when you visited a particular site. The purpose of it is to tailor the operation to your needs through data gathered and remembered your patterns and preferences.
Tracking cookies or third-party tracking cookies are used to compile more information about the user from other third-party sources that the user might be associated with.
